Since 1995, Thirst No More has been working with people around the world who live in hopeless situations. Whether it's war, tyranny, or disasters, TNM has been on the front lines of human suffering offering aid to those who need it most. Thirst No More has been chosen by thousands of donors as an effective and efficient means of rushing aid to those who need it most. Our field workers and network of partners have given us quick access to the most troubled regions of the world. Thousands of volunteers have made it possible to stretch our resources for maximum impact. Thank you for your interest in becoming a part of this global team.
Thirst No More is an international association of churches with 501(c)3 non-profit status. Gifts in the United States are tax deductible. TNM is governed by a board of directors which provides oversight to its activities and finances. Any funds donated for benevolence purposes will be put in to a Disaster Relief Fund and distributed at the discretion of the board of directors.
